Description

4-(3-Chlorophenyl)Butanoicacid CAS NO 22991-05-5 is a versatile chlorinated aromatic carboxylic acid derivative, serving as a key organic intermediate in advanced synthesis. Its value lies in providing a functionalized phenylbutanoic acid scaffold for constructing more complex molecules. This compound is primarily needed by research institutions and manufacturers in the pharmaceutical, agrochemical, and specialty chemical industries for developing active ingredients and novel materials.

Basic Information

Product Name 4-(3-Chlorophenyl)Butanoicacid
CAS No. 22991-05-5
Molecular Formula C10H11ClO2
Molecular Weight 198.65 g/mol
Synonyms 4-(3-Chlorophenyl)butyric acid; 3-Chlorobenzene butanoic acid; γ-(3-Chlorophenyl)butyric acid; (3-Chlorophenyl)butanoic acid; 4-(m-Chlorophenyl)butanoic acid; 22991-05-5; Butanoic acid, 4-(3-chlorophenyl)-; m-Chlorophenylbutyric acid

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area away from incompatible materials such as strong bases and oxidizing agents. Recommended storage temperature is between 15°C and 25°C. Keep container tightly sealed when not in use to minimize exposure to moisture.
